시장 성장 요인

산업화는 산업용 사물인터넷(IIoT)을 채택하여 연결된 지능형 산업 생태계를 구축하는 것이 특징입니다. 디지털 유틸리티 솔루션은 에너지 집약적인 산업 공정의 연결과 최적화에 기여합니다. 따라서 도시화 및 산업화 추세로 인해 시장이 크게 확대되고 있습니다.

회복력 계획에는 예측 분석을 사용하여 자연재해에 대한 조기 경보 시스템을 개발하는 것이 포함됩니다. AI와 데이터 분석을 통해 전력회사는 잠재적인 위협을 예측하고 중요한 인프라를 보호하기 위한 사전 조치를 취할 수 있습니다. 따라서 탄력성 계획과 재난 관리로 인해 시장이 크게 확대될 것으로 예상됩니다.

시장 성장 억제요인

전력회사 간의 재정적 능력 격차는 디지털 기술에 대한 접근의 불평등을 초래할 수 있습니다. 대형 전력회사나 경제적으로 탄탄한 지역에 위치한 전력회사는 고급 솔루션에 투자할 수 있는 재정적 능력이 있을 수 있으며, 소규모 전력회사는 불리한 위치에 놓일 수 있습니다. 따라서 고가의 초기 투자는 시장 성장을 지연시킬 수 있습니다.

Market Growth Factors

Industrialization is marked by adopting the Industrial Internet of Things (IIoT) to create connected and intelligent industrial ecosystems. Digital utility solutions contribute to the connectivity and optimization of energy-intensive industrial processes. Therefore, the market is expanding significantly due to the increasing trends in urbanization and industrialization.

Resilience planning involves using predictive analytics to develop early warning systems for natural disasters. AI and data analytics enable utilities to forecast potential threats and take proactive measures to safeguard critical infrastructure. Thus, because of the resilience planning and disaster management, the market is anticipated to increase significantly.

Market Restraining Factors

The disparity in financial capabilities among utilities can lead to unequal access to digital technologies. Larger utilities or those in economically robust regions may have the financial capacity to invest in advanced solutions, leaving smaller utilities disadvantaged. Thus, high initial investment can slow down the growth of the market.

By Technology Analysis

By technology, the market is categorized into hardware and integrated solutions. The integrated solutions segment covered 34.6% revenue share in the digital utility market in 2022 Integrated solutions enable utilities to manage diverse aspects of their operations through a unified system. This ensures that utilities can engage with customers through their preferred channels, fostering stronger connections.

By Network Analysis

Based on network, the market is classified into generation, transmission & distribution, and retail. In 2022, the generation segment witnessed 41.1% revenue share in the market. The generation segment leverages big data analytics to process large volumes of data generated by power plants and grid operations.

By Regional Analysis

Region-wise, the market is analysed across North America, Europe, Asia Pacific, and LAMEA. In 2022, the North America region led the digital utility market by generating 33.2% revenue share. North America has numerous research and innovation centers focused on advancing digital utility technologies.
